Main ore of lead is gaalena.This is mined and separated from other minerals by froth flotation.There are two methods of extracting the lead.
(i)First method involves the roasting of ore followed by
reduction with coke or CO.
(ii)Second method involves the partial roasting of ore followed by
self reduction.

To determine which statement is incorrect about the extraction of lead from galena (PbS), we need to analyze the provided methods of extraction and the statements regarding them. ### Step-by-Step Solution: 1. **Identify the Ore and Its Concentration Method**: - The main ore of lead is galena (PbS). - Galena is concentrated by the froth flotation method, which is suitable for sulfide ores. 2. **Understand the Extraction Methods**: - **First Method**: This involves roasting the ore followed by reduction with coke or carbon monoxide (CO). - Roasting converts PbS to PbO: \[ 2 \text{PbS} + 3 \text{O}_2 \rightarrow 2 \text{PbO} + 2 \text{SO}_2 \] - Then, PbO is reduced to lead (Pb) using coke or CO: \[ \text{PbO} + \text{C} \rightarrow \text{Pb} + \text{CO} \] - **Second Method**: This involves partial roasting of the ore followed by self-reduction. - Partial roasting also produces PbO and SO2: \[ 2 \text{PbS} + 3 \text{O}_2 \rightarrow 2 \text{PbO} + 2 \text{SO}_2 \] - The self-reduction occurs when PbO reacts with unreacted PbS: \[ 2 \text{PbO} + \text{PbS} \rightarrow 3 \text{Pb} + \text{SO}_2 \] 3. **Evaluate Each Statement**: - **Statement 1**: "Galena is a sulfide ore and is concentrated by froth flotation." - This statement is **correct**. - **Statement 2**: "Self-reduction takes place in the absence of air." - This statement is **correct** as self-reduction occurs without additional oxidizing agents. - **Statement 3**: "Complete roasting of galena gives PbO which is then reduced." - This statement is **correct** as it accurately describes the roasting and reduction process. - **Statement 4**: "FeSiO3 is obtained as the slag." - This statement is **incorrect**. FeSiO3 (silicate slag) is typically associated with the extraction of copper, not lead. 4. **Conclusion**: - The incorrect statement about the extraction of lead from galena is **Statement 4**. ### Final Answer: The incorrect statement about the extraction of lead from galena is: **"FeSiO3 is obtained as the slag."** ---
